Three Sun Valley Ski Education Foundation Alpine U12 and U14 athletes climbed the podium in the IMD Spring Fling this past week.

SVSEF Alpine U12 North Series athletes traveled to Grand Targhee, Wyo., April 3-5 alongside first-year SVSEF Alpine U14 IMD athletes, to take part in the always highly anticipated IMD Spring Fling.

Athletes from both teams raced to great success, with podiums in every discipline for both the girls and boys over the course of the three days.

Alta Questad (U12) topped the results for the girls with a first place and two second-place finishes. Alex Grant (U14) and Walker Gove (U12) each brought home two podium finishes for the boys.

IMD Spring Fling is a great end of the season fun race for U12 and U14 athletes from the Intermountain Division, with athletes joining from the Northern Division as well. The race weekend offers an opportunity for U12 athletes to race with U14s, and for first-year U14s to have a final race of the season while the second-year U14s race the Snow Cup Series with U16s at Snowbird.

The dual format Slalom race and Kombi make for a fun weekend of racing. The Kombi offers a mix of features from giant slalom gates, to stubbie (short slalom gates) and tall pole slalom, as well as wildcard features like pole jumpers.

Pole jumpers are drills where skiers jump over poles placed across the slope to demonstrate their balance and athletic stance.

“We had a great weekend of racing,” said Ben Roberts, SVSEF Alpine First-Year U14 Head Coach. “The Grand Targhee race crew dug deep and delivered three great days of racing—we even had a powder day! It was great seeing our SVSEF athletes finish the season strong competitively and having fun skiing with their friends.”

The conclusion of the 2025/26 season will see the U12 North Series athletes transition to become first-year U14s and the first-year U14s grow into second-year U14s. The second-year U14s who choose to continue ski racing will move to the U16 Team.
